I've been to Magpie twice and both times were disappointing. The first time I got a hot chai and I could not taste the chai at all. The second time I went, I got a mocha and it tasted like the shot was burnt. A friend once got one of their salted seasonal drinks and it was way too salty and they had their drink re-made. A different friend ordered the avocado toast, which was way too salty and the presentation looked messy. Additionally, the staff do not seem particularly concerned with customer service. This is nit-picky, but there were two staff members who were engaging in conversation very loudly for over 20 minutes, disturbing the ambience. Overall, there are many other coffee shops around Eugene with better coffee, prices, customer service, and ambience.

I always go to Magpie when I have an essay or a test to study for. I have a summer class I am wrapping up for and went in last week. I love how much sunlight there is and I always get an iced latte with oat milk and usually a baked good. I got the biscuit with butter and jam this time and it was really good. The staff is also really friendly and the music is at a good volume. I really recommend it for a nice study spot.
